UV-Vis spectroscopy, often known as ultraviolet-visible spectroscopy, is a way that is made use of to review the conversation of issue and electromagnetic radiation. It exclusively bargains with the absorption of ultraviolet (UV) and visible mild by a sample. The sample is subjected to a wide array of wavelengths of sunshine and the absorption of sunshine at various wavelengths is measured. The resulting information is plotted as being a spectrum, from which the sample’s absorbance or transmittance is usually decided.
Analyze of Molecular Structure: The absorption pattern in UV spectroscopy can provide insights into the molecular composition of a compound. It can help in knowing the Digital construction and the nature of chemical bonds in a molecule.
Quantitative Evaluation: It truly is extensively utilized for quantifying the concentration of the substance in a mixture. Based on the Beer-Lambert Regulation, the amount of gentle absorbed by a material is instantly proportional to its focus, letting for accurate measurements.

Impact of Sample Temperature: Temperature variants while in the sample can substantially influence the spectrum. Given that the temperature decreases, the sharpness of absorption bands intensifies. However, the total absorption depth stays unaffected by temperature improvements.
UV spectroscopy is style of absorption spectroscopy through which light-weight of ultra-violet location (200-400 nm) is absorbed by the molecule which results in the excitation of the electrons from the bottom state to bigger Power point out.
